Is Java dying in 2025?
No, Java isn't dying in 2025; it remains a massive, relevant language, especially in large enterprises, but its dominance for new backend projects is challenged by languages like Kotlin and Go, which offer less friction, while Java's strong community and vast existing ecosystem ensure its continued use for years, though its share of new projects may shrink as modern alternatives gain traction.Is Java outdated in 2025?
Java remains a powerhouse in the programming world, even as we approach 2025. This versatile language continues to be a top choice for developers across various industries. Java is still widely used in 2025, with over 90% of Fortune 500 companies employing it for their software development needs.Is Java safe in 2025?
Is Java safe, or is Java outdated? In 2025, it is still be relevant and safe in comparison to other programming languages. Make use of the most recent Java version. Using outdated versions of Java can lead to security flaws.Is Java dead in the future?
Conclusion. Java isn't dead. It isn't even dying.Which coding language is in demand in 2025?
Python: The Versatile VanguardIn 2025, this language takes the lead, and others follow. The PYPL PopularitY of Programming Language chart reveals Python's impressive performance.
Is Java Dying in 2025?
Should I learn Java or Python?
If you're a beginner interested in learning to code, Python and its simplicity and readability may be a good place to start. If you're more interested in computer science and engineering, it might be beneficial to start with Java. You may find that learning Python becomes easier once you have already learned Java.Was Elon Musk a coder?
Yes, Elon Musk was a self-taught programmer who started at age 10, learning BASIC and creating his first video game, Blastar, at 12, selling the code for $500; this fundamental understanding of software has been a thread through his career, enabling his ventures like Zip2, PayPal, and shaping Tesla and SpaceX.What is replacing Java?
Developed by JetBrains, Kotlin offers seamless interoperability with Java, concise syntax, and advanced features like null safety and coroutines. It leverages Java libraries and frameworks while addressing some of Java's shortcomings, making it a popular choice for Android development and modern web applications.What is the Java killer language?
The Bottom Line: Java isn't dead. But Go is the language Java would have been if it were designed for the cloud-native era. If you're starting fresh — especially in cloud, containers, or real-time systems — Go is a compelling choice.Is C++ worse than Java?
Most experts will tell you that Java is easier to learn. It's a newer language than C++ and isn't as complex in its principles or execution. However, you'll want to consider more than a language's learning curve. Selecting a programming language depends on what you want to do with it.Will Java be replaced by AI?
Moreover, the demand for skilled Java developers remains strong as more businesses rely on Java for their digital solutions. Hence, while AI can enhance productivity, it is not poised to replace Java developers completely.Who earns more, Python or Java developer?
Ans: Python (₹6–11 LPA average) beats Java (₹5–9 LPA), especially in AI and startups.Should I learn Java or go in 2025?
Despite the rise of other languages like Python, JavaScript, and Go, Java continues to hold a significant position in the world of software development. So, the question arises: Is Java still relevant in 2025? The answer is a resounding yes.Are companies moving away from Java?
Oracle Java's licensing and pricing challenges are pushing companies to explore alternatives. Many are considering migrating to an OpenJDK distribution, and some are even considering removing Java in favor of another programming language.Which is the no. 1 coding language?
General-Purpose Programming Languages (2026 Edition)- Python. Python remains the world's most versatile programming language. ...
- Java. Java continues to anchor enterprise systems and large-scale applications worldwide. ...
- C++ ...
- Go (Golang) ...
- Rust. ...
- Swift. ...
- C.
Is 27 too late to start coding?
It's never too late to learn a programming language. Some job seekers who are older may initially doubt their ability to learn coding because of a lack of experience or fear of employment bias. But, the reality is that learning a new skill takes time and dedication, no matter your age.Who is faster, C++ or Java?
While C++ is generally considered faster due to its low-level nature and native execution, Java offers modern runtime optimizations that can close the gap in certain scenarios.Why is Java losing popularity?
There are many reasons for this, not the least Java's enjoyability to code with. "Java is verbose," says TIOBE founder Paul Jansen. "You have to write, relatively, a lot of code to get something done. Programmers don't like that." For some, this can be an advantage; as one Java dev on Hackernews says, "I love boring.Does NASA use C++ or Python?
C and C++ remain the backbone of NASA's flight software, providing precise hardware control and deterministic memory management, while Python is used extensively for data analysis and scientific computing.Is C-Sharp basically Java?
Java is class-based, while C# is component-oriented. C# supports pointers for overloading, whereas Java does not. Java does not support pointers at all, whereas C# supports pointers when running in unsafe mode. Java arrays are a specialization of Object, while in C# they are a specialization of System.Is Python taking over Java?
In 2023, Python's popularity soared to 48.24%, while Java maintained a substantial market share of 35.35%. For developers, both budding and seasoned, aligning with the right language is a cornerstone for project success.Which language is closest to Java?
With that in mind, here are some of the most popular languages similar to Java:- Kotlin.
- TypeScript.
- Python.
- JavaScript.
- Swift.
- Dart.
- C++
- Rust.
What is Elon Musk's 5 minute rule?
Elon Musk's "5-Minute Rule" is a time management strategy called time blocking, where he meticulously divides his day into small, five-minute increments, assigning a specific task to each block to maximize focus, avoid multitasking, and eliminate procrastination by ensuring every minute has a purpose. While some sources suggest it also includes doing any task taking under 5 minutes immediately, the core concept is structured timeboxing, sometimes managed by his assistants, allowing for intense focus on critical work and minimizing context switching.Was Jeff Bezos a programmer?
Also, Bezos was a Computer Science major and a developer for 4 years after graduation. Jeff's original request for S3 was, as I recall, along the lines of "We need malloc() for the Internet."What is Elon Musk diagnosed with?
Elon Musk has stated he has Asperger's syndrome, a condition now understood as part of Autism Spectrum Disorder (ASD), which he publicly revealed during his 2021 appearance on Saturday Night Live (SNL). He described it as a first-time public admission by someone with Asperger's hosting the show, sparking conversations about neurodiversity and adult diagnoses, though Asperger's is no longer a separate diagnosis in clinical terms.
← Previous question
How many EVs is one protein?
How many EVs is one protein?
Next question →
Was Joel's death just a dream?
Was Joel's death just a dream?